thermal: gov_power_allocator: Use .manage() callback instead of .throttle()



The Power Allocator governor really only wants to be called once per
thermal zone update and it does a special check to skip the extra,
from its perspective, invocations of the .throttle() callback.

Make it use .manage() instead of .throttle().
